扩大MySQL性能:操作配置MySQL扩展(配置mysql扩展)

MySQL是Web应用程序开发者最受欢迎的数据库管理系统,其大部分企业级应用程序建立在 MySQL 平台之上。由于MySQL性能的优越,使它的开发者有一个可靠的稳定的数据库系统。但是这些能力有时会引起用户的担忧,因为在某些情况下,MySQL的处理时间以及查询性能可能不够快速。为了改善这种情况,用户可以考虑采取操作配置MySQL扩展的方式来扩大MySQL性能。

首先,提高MySQL数据库系统的性能,需要改变MySQL配置文件中关于知名系统变量的一些值。以下是典型的MySQL参数:max_connections,key_buffer_size,query_cache_size,sort_buffer_size,join_buffer_size,read_buffer_size和thread_cache_size。这些参数的取值根据应用的情况不同而有所不同,这些参数的大小会直接影响MySQL性能。因此,用户可以根据自身的实际条件来调整这些参数值,以帮助提高MySQL处理能力。

另外,使用索引也会提高MySQL查询性能。索引可以有效地减少查询结果搜索和排序的时间,使查询变得更快,更有效率。目前,MySQL的存储引擎支持复制索引、组合索引和聚合索引。在许多情况下,在数据表中添加正确的索引可以大大提高MySQL的查询性能。

此外,如果数据库有多个表之间的联接,那么联结查询的性能也会受到有关配置的影响。配置表连接非常重要,通过将每个表连接在一起可以大大提高查询性能。同时,如果查询只需要少量字段,就应该避免在数据库中查询多余的字段,因为这会影响查询的效率。

最后,重要的是要定期的对MySQL数据库进行优化。MySQL数据库优化涉及对数据表结构的重新组织,在存储引擎中优化数据,并使用分析和统计工具跟踪系统性能随时间的变化。通过做这些会让MySQL应用性能更好,可以更好地满足用户的需要。

总之,扩大MySQL性能需要采取有效的操作配置方法来改进MySQL处理能力。用户可以在MySQL参数、索引使用和表连接上进行重新配置,以及定期优化MySQL数据库,以帮助提高MySQL性能。


数据运维技术 » 扩大MySQL性能:操作配置MySQL扩展(配置mysql扩展)